Petoi is a robotics company founded 2016, based in China, developing 4 robots primarily in the Education category.
Maker of futuristic robotic pets for STEM education and hobbyists, featuring open-source legged robots like Nybble and Bittle.
Petoi LLC designs and sells open-source legged robotic pets, including the cat-like Nybble and dog-like Bittle (and Bittle X), built for STEM education, hobbyists, and robotics researchers. Products use Arduino-compatible microcontrollers (Nyboard), ESP32, and Raspberry Pi, with firmware based on the OpenCat framework. Buyers include educators, students, and research labs globally. The company operates from Dongguan, China, and emphasizes hands-on robotics learning through affordable, customizable pet robots.

Milestones
Nybble Q model introduced with updated design.
Bittle X+ARM model released with enhanced capabilities.
Bittle robotic dog launched two years after Nybble.
Nybble robotic cat launched with successful crowdfunding campaign.
Founded by Rongzhong Li as the OpenCat open-source robotic pet project.
